The Shadow of the Rails: Exploring the Potential Link Between Railroad Settlements and Esophageal Cancer

Esophageal cancer, a powerful illness affecting television connecting the throat to the stomach, continues to be a significant health concern globally. While recognized threat elements like smoking cigarettes, extreme alcohol intake, and acid reflux are extensively recognized, emerging research study and historical context are prompting investigations into less conventional links. One such area of concern centers around railroad settlements and the potential increased danger of esophageal cancer for those who lived and operated in these environments. This article explores the potential connection, checking out the historic context of railroad settlements, the occupational and ecological exposures related to them, and the existing evidence that suggests a relationship with this devastating disease.

Esophageal cancer ranks as the 8th most typical cancer around the world and the sixth leading cause of cancer-related deaths. It manifests in 2 main forms: squamous cell cancer, frequently connected to smoking and alcohol, and adenocarcinoma, often associated with chronic heartburn and obesity. Recognizing risk aspects is essential for early detection and avoidance, but for people connected to railroad settlements, the landscape of threat elements might extend beyond the standard.

The growth of railways throughout the 19th and 20th centuries stimulated the growth of many settlements and communities. These areas, typically strategically positioned near rail lawns, upkeep centers, and train depots, ended up being hubs of activity for railroad workers and their families. While supplying work and community, these settlements typically exposed residents to a special mixed drink of occupational and ecological threats intrinsic to the railroad market of the period.

Understanding the Potential Exposures in Railroad Settlements:

The every day life around railroad settlements, particularly during the peak of rail transport, included direct exposure to a range of substances now recognized as prospective carcinogens. These direct exposures can be classified into occupational dangers for railroad workers and environmental pollutants affecting homeowners of the settlements.

Occupational Hazards for Railroad Workers:

For those directly employed by the railroad, the workplace provided a multitude of threats:

  • Diesel Exhaust: Railroads heavily depended on diesel engines, specifically as they transitioned far from steam power. Diesel exhaust is a complicated mixture including numerous carcinogenic compounds, including polycyclic fragrant hydrocarbons (PAHs) and particulate matter. Prolonged exposure to diesel exhaust, typical in rail lawns, repair shops, and train operations, is a well-documented threat aspect for lung cancer and is progressively linked in other cancers, including esophageal cancer.
  • Asbestos: Until the late 20th century, asbestos was commonly utilized in railroad applications for insulation in locomotives, rail vehicles, and buildings, as well as in brake linings and clutches. Asbestos fibers, when inhaled, are well-known for causing mesothelioma and lung cancer, however evidence likewise suggests a link to cancers of the throat, ovary, and potentially the esophagus.
  • Creosote: This wood preservative was extensively used to deal with railroad ties, securing them from decay and lengthening their life-span. Creosote contains PAHs and phenols, understood carcinogens. Workers handling creosote-treated ties, and those living near locations where treated ties were saved, could have experienced significant exposure.
  • Herbicides and Pesticides: Maintaining railroad tracks and rights-of-way involved making use of herbicides and pesticides to control vegetation and pests. A few of these chemical compounds, particularly older solutions, have been connected to numerous cancers.
  • Solvents and Degreasers: Railroad upkeep and repair work operations involved making use of different solvents and degreasers for cleaning and maintaining equipment. Specific solvents, like benzene and chlorinated solvents, are known or believed carcinogens.
  • Heavy Metals: Exposure to heavy metals like arsenic, chromium, and nickel could occur through various railroad activities, including welding, metal work, and handling cured wood. Certain heavy metals are recognized carcinogens and have actually been linked to a variety of cancers.

Environmental Contaminants in Railroad Settlements:

Beyond occupational dangers, residents of railroad settlements, even those not directly used by the railroad, might have been exposed to environmental contaminants stemming from railroad activities:

  • Air Pollution: Rail lawns and industrial railroad locations could produce considerable air pollution, including diesel exhaust fumes, particle matter from coal and diesel combustion, and dust from numerous commercial processes. This ambient air contamination might expose whole communities to carcinogenic compounds.
  • Soil and Water Contamination: Spills, leakages, and inappropriate disposal of railroad-related chemicals, including creosote, herbicides, solvents, and heavy metals, might infect the soil and water sources around railroad settlements. This contamination might lead to long-lasting direct exposure through consumption, skin contact, and inhalation of polluted dust.
  • Proximity to Industrial Activities: Railroad settlements were often located near other commercial sites and rail-dependent markets, possibly exposing homeowners to a cumulative effect of industrial pollutants in addition to railroad-specific hazards.

Evidence Linking Railroad Exposures and Esophageal Cancer:

While direct, large-scale epidemiological research studies specifically concentrating on esophageal cancer incidence in railroad settlements may be limited, a body of proof supports the plausibility of a link:

  • Studies on Railroad Workers and Cancer: Several studies have actually examined cancer incidence amongst railroad employees. Some have actually shown raised risks of various cancers, including lung cancer and bladder cancer, which are frequently associated with exposures like diesel exhaust and asbestos. While less studies may specifically target esophageal cancer, the recognized carcinogens present in the railroad environment are recognized danger elements for multiple cancer types, including esophageal cancer.
  • Research on Specific Carcinogens and Esophageal Cancer: Extensive research has established links between specific compounds widespread in railroad settings and esophageal cancer. For example, studies have suggested that exposure to PAHs, discovered in diesel exhaust and creosote, can increase the risk of esophageal squamous cell cancer. Likewise, while asbestos is more strongly connected to other cancers, some studies recommend a prospective association with esophageal cancer too.
  • Case-Control Studies and Occupational Histories: Case-control research studies taking a look at esophageal cancer clients have actually sometimes revealed occupational histories including railroad work, suggesting a possible association. These studies add to the general picture, even if they don't definitively prove causation.

It is crucial to note that developing a conclusive causal link in between railroad settlement residency and esophageal cancer is complex. Esophageal cancer is multifactorial, and isolating the particular contribution of railroad direct exposures from other established danger aspects requires rigorous epidemiological research. Additionally, historical direct exposure data from railroad settlements may be incomplete or hard to rebuild.

Regularly Asked Questions (FAQs)

Q1: What is esophageal cancer?Esophageal cancer is a type of cancer that takes place in the esophagus, the muscular tube that carries food and liquids from your throat to your stomach. There are 2 primary types: squamous cell cancer and adenocarcinoma.

Q2: What are the recognized threat aspects for esophageal cancer?Developed risk elements consist of smoking, extreme alcohol intake, chronic heartburn (GERD), obesity, Barrett's esophagus, and certain dietary factors.

Q3: How could living or operating in a railroad settlement potentially increase the threat of esophageal cancer?People in railroad settlements might have been exposed to various carcinogens, consisting of diesel exhaust, asbestos, creosote, herbicides, solvents, and heavy metals, through occupational activities and ecological contamination. These compounds are understood or presumed risk elements for various cancers, including potentially esophageal cancer.

Q4: What are some symptoms of esophageal cancer?Symptoms can consist of difficulty swallowing (dysphagia), unusual weight reduction, chest pain or pressure, heartburn, coughing or hoarseness, and throwing up.

Q5: What can people who lived or worked in railroad settlements do to reduce their danger of esophageal cancer?Key steps include giving up smoking cigarettes, moderating alcohol consumption, maintaining a healthy diet plan and weight, going through regular medical check-ups, and, for current railroad workers, adhering to office safety procedures.
